  4. Dutch Fort

    Pangkor Island, 32300 Pangkor, Perak, Malaysia

    The Dutch Fort is a historical landmark on Pangkor Island, built in the 17th century by the Dutch. It's a great place to learn about the island's history and culture, and offers stunning views of the surrounding area.
